Oil Refinery Novi Sad was destroyed 1999th and there was a spill of large quantities of oil and oil products on the land. Spilled oil has significant amounts of heavy metals what caused heavy metals contamination of soil. The aim of this study was to examine the application of phytoremediation with different poplar genotypes for the treatment of contaminated soil. The experiment was constructed as greenhouse semi-controlled pot grown poplar plants in soil with varying degrees oil contamination. The effect of oil pollution on changes in soil concentrations of metals and metals in plants, as well as impacts on vitality of plants were investigated. The results showed that there is no single most efficient clone to remove all metal and at all concentrations of pollution.
